“Molly” is a new hip-hop track by the Chicago-based artist Dissidence. The project was started by Dissidence as an experiment to blend the subgenres of hip-hop and electronic music. His tracks are mostly inspired by artists and bands like GothBoiClique, Drain Gang, Salem, and Smokedope2016, having a mix of emotions and harsh music.

Molly is a reflection of pain and a sign of hope for those fighting a battle on their own. 

The new single is based on the lines of drug addiction and the feeling of being lost in the battle of life. The emotionally drawn track stems from a personal experience of the artist. Through the medium of music, Dissidence wants to capture the feeling of many who suffer silently. The hard-hitting production, blended with vulnerable lyrics and harsh beats, is heavy on meaning and honest in nature. This one is for all the hip-hop fans who prefer raw and vulnerable music.
